Requirements: Harriet so needs a terrier home. She is currently high energy and focused on her ball if allowed. Unassessed in a home as yet. Definitely secure terrier-proof garden and exit management as she is keen to follow!
Her Story: Harriet was passed on to us via the police so unsure of previous circumstance. Her chip registered to her breeder as a Jack Russell x Pug and born 18th Nov 2009. Harriet will be spayed this week and 1st vax'd. In boarding kennels near Gatwick, Surrey
Advert: Harriet is fast ... like a jump jet! She is feminine, licky and given a ball, she knows how to determinedly place it, then tells you anxiously what your part in this game is, indeed! We are just assessing her lead walking and mixing with other dogs outside on her walks, but she meets dogs very well through the kennel door. Always delighted to see her lead. Her intelligence is bright, focused and attuned to what is on offer; food, fun, walks or love!
Harriet looks just like a fawn 'Pug' but that nose is just a tad too pointy! She also has a 'wiry' body, longer legs and a focused mind; the look in her eye is 100% terrier. She is Jack Russell in instinct and attitude. You are seeing one dog and witnessing something else. She runs like the wind and would need due care leaving the house as she'd be the leader if you let her!
